Project Summary

RESOLVE: CRD programme aims to promote awareness, understanding & innovation on a local, national, Balkans, EU & international-level focusing on social conflicts affecting young people (YP) throughout Europe: Eastern Europe/the Balkans (Bosnia-i-Herzegovina), Western Europe (UK), Nordic Europe (Sweden), Mediterranean Europe (Italy) & through a Continuous Professional Development Network throughout Europe.RESOLVE: CRD develops innovative reconciliation-focused training methodologies, pedagogical materials & toolkits designed to develop the skillset & competences of Youth Workers, Educators, Trainers, Mental Health professionals, Community specialists etc. working with YP, affected by conflicts – both community-level, violent conflicts & post-conflicts situations.Utilising the expertise of partners based throughout Europe, RESOLVE aims to develop the professional skillsets of youth professionals working on community conflict & post-conflict issues, developing societies’ much needed Community Reconciliation Champions at a time where there exists so much intolerance throughout our communities; youth conflicts; & young peoples’ lives affected by post-violence. RESOLVE aims to ensure that this skillset is standardized through the design & implementation of a Continuous Professional Development (CPD) strategy and promoted through the current RESOLVE: Network launched by UK Partner Asfar, in partnership with Wings of Hope in 2018. The RESOLVE CPD strategy will ensure that each Reconciliation/Peacebuilder professional are suitably trained in their profession with specific focus in working with YP, address the current skills gap, lack of professionalisation of the Reconciliation youth sector & recognition of the sectors’ achievements.RESOLVE aims to develop the reconciliation skillsets in Mental Health professionals who work with young people significantly effected by conflict, post-conflict & community conflict issues through the design of a unique reconciliation training methodology designed for mental health workers, to become key community reconciliation professionals within the youth sector.Linking the Mental Health sector with the Reconciliation youth sector, RESOLVE will design & mobilise a unique pedagogical programme aimed at addressing Burnout amongst Reconciliation community/youth sector professionals. Working in a conflict zone (whether post-conflict, current conflict or on a community conflict level), results in significant burnout for professionals, with limited support of burnout prevention in existence throughout the Balkans or the rest of Europe. Through the strategic design & launch of a awareness campaign, the RESOLVE: CRD partnership will increase awareness & understanding on burnout in Reconciliation Youth professionals & will provide guidance, prevention support & management of burnout to community professionals working in reconciliation with young people.
